如何基于子值及其结构中的多个键,通过Rest API在Firebase中检索记录?

问题描述

我的Firebase数据库中具有以下结构:

- Items (L1)
  -- key (L2)
    --- itemId (L3)
    --- itemName (L3)
    --- ....
- Orders (L1)
  -- key (L2)
    --- key (L3)
       ---- itemId (L4)
       ---- itemName (L4)
       ---- itemQty (L4)

我为订单设置了以下索引。

    "orders": {
      "$custId": {
         ".indexOn" : "itemId","$orderId" : {
          ".indexOn" : "itemId"
        }
      }
    },

我想提取特定itemId(例如1011)的所有订单。我试图利用Google恐龙示例。但是,也许因为我的订单结构中有两个关键级别,所以我无法使其正常工作。

我想以RestAPI的形式编写请求,例如: var url ='https://xxxx.firebaseio.com/orders.json?orderBy=“ itemId”&equalTo = 1011';

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)